The arrival of the AccurioJet KM-1 at the Melbourne trade show drew lot of attention, even before the doors opened. The high-speed sheetfed UV inkjet is a radical departure for Konica Minolta, moving it up into the production market.
The sale of a Versant 180 colour digital press to Melbourne printer Dinkums Print & Design marks Fuji Xerox's 650th Versant sale around the country. The milestone deal was announced on the opening day of PacPrint 2017 in Melbourne.
The new UVgel ink technology on Canon's Océ Colorado 1640 wide-format roll-fed digital printer has earned it a Print21 Technology Hot Pick for PacPrint 2017. The ink has the 'consistency of a hair gel', according to Océ's Paul Whitehead.

European digital printing giant Xeikon has kicked off its first-ever PacPrint with a Print21 Technology Hot Pick for its CX-3 "Cheetah" label press. The toner-based five-colour digital label press is running live on stand A22. Xeikon, a subsidiary of Flint Group, launched in Australia in February.

Collapsed Melbourne printer Print Dynamics has offered unsecured creditors owed a total of $1.3 million a take-it-or-leave-it, 10 cents-in-the-dollar settlement deal. The offer is conditional on all creditors agreeing to the terms. The company says it also owes employees $581,067.17.
